Course #: 5905
Course: THEATRE ARTS II
Credit: 1.0 Grade Placement: 10-12
Prerequisites: Theatre Arts I or Equivalent and Teacher Recommendation
Course Description: Theatre Arts II is designed to emphasize advanced study in
two areas: acting and design. Course units will include the study of advanced
acting techniques and application of the design elements for the stage through
group and individual projects. Involvement in co-curricular productions,
contests, and/or other such activities is an integral requirement of the class.

Course #:5906
Course: THEATRE ARTS III
Credit: 1.0 Grade Placement: 11 – 12
Prerequisites: Theatre Arts I and II or Equivalent and Teacher
Recommendation
Course Description: Theatre Arts III provides the third year student with
advanced actor training, a broad understanding of dramatic literature, and
training in the specialized skills of playwriting, design and directing.
Involvement in co-curricular productions, contests, and/or other such activities
is an integral requirement of the class.

Course #: 5907
Course: THEATRE ARTS IV
Credit: 1.0 Grade Placement: 12
Prerequisites: Theatre Arts I, II, III or Equivalent and Teacher
Recommendation
Course Description: Theatre Arts IV continues to provide the advanced theatre
student with extensive actor preparation as well as specialized training in
areas of special interest to the individual student. Among these are theatre
literature, design, directing, and playwriting. Emphasis is on the refinement
of skills. Involvement in co-curricular productions, contests, and/or other
such activities is an integral requirement of the class.

Course #: 5910
Course: THEATRE PRODUCTION I
Credit: 1.0 Grade Placement: 9 – 12
Prerequisites: Teacher Recommendation
Course Description: This course focuses on all aspects of theatrical
production: acting concepts and skills, production concepts and skills, and
aesthetic growth through appreciation of theatrical events. Students will share
in the theatre experience by working in the various areas associated with
overall production. Involvement in co-curricular production activities is an
integral and essential requirement of theatre production.
NOTE: A student may sign up for a Theatre production class offered during the
regular school day or may receive credit through 80 hours (1/2 unit) to 160
hours (1 unit) of involvement in production activities and theatrical
experiences outside the school day as specified in Chapter 75 and explained in
TEA Guidelines. All work must be completed during the academic year and no more
than one unit of credit in Theatre Production may be earned during any one
school year.
